Transaction 3c95335a10ca230a50cc5afc7b3106d88d4fd6a51364cfce95627a212de4a694
1 Input
1 Output
-
3c95335a10ca230a50cc5afc7b3106d88d4fd6a51364cfce95627a212de4a694:0
- value
- 11784430
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 964108bff0f66dd0a0bf566e0f072cfe7d717a4c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EhUGRrYvES9tq8dxMCfNxfDUpiobQV8y8